A tropical storm warning was issued for the Panhandle east to the Aucilla River.The disturbance, which was moving north-northeast at 9 mph through the gulf, is projected to become a tropical or subtropical storm by Friday morning. And, a tornado watch has now been issued for all local counties.

Tropical storm warnings were also issued Thursday afternoon for Alabama and Mississippi’s coasts.The storm is expected to turn toward the northeast Thursday night, and a northeastward motion at a faster forward speed is expected on Friday and Saturday. It’s a fast moving storm, so by late Saturday into Sunday we will be drying things out.
